Mantra Mahodadhi English Translation PDF: A Complete Guide The , literally translated as the "Ocean of Mantras," is one of the most authoritative and comprehensive compendiums of Hindu Tantra and ritual science. Authored by Mahidhara in 1588–1589 CE while he lived as an anchorite in Varanasi, this monumental work consists of roughly 3,300 verses spread across 25 chapters (Tarangas). It typically consists of 25 Tarangas (waves/chapters).
The work is deeply rooted in the belief that mantras are the very "body" of the deities. It establishes a clear and profound connection between the (the formulation of sacred sounds), the murti (the visualizable form of the deity), and tantra (the actual ritual practice). This principle is the guiding theme of the entire book.
